PT Integrated Arts Instructor

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

About the position The Integrated Arts Instructor is responsible for facilitating engaging, person-centered art and music classes for program participants across multiple service sites in Pierce County. This position will lead two-hour classes at two of our four Pierce County locations. The role is scheduled for 18.75 hours per week, delivered over two and one-half days per week. This is a hybrid position, with the designated home office located at our Tacoma office building. Regular travel between home office and assigned Pierce County sites is required with the company vehicle.
